Output 682a3cbdd1f4b764679a917215ed5d7ada2ad4237cd05a78b34dd8ae96a047ac:2

value
645020659
script pubkey
OP_0 OP_PUSHBYTES_20 e5d2cd6da6181307b38b4805082d9b128ab8e7a6
address
bc1quhfv6mdxrqfs0vutfqzsstvmz29t3eax7jz6ly
transaction
682a3cbdd1f4b764679a917215ed5d7ada2ad4237cd05a78b34dd8ae96a047ac
spent
true